TECHNICAL SPECIFICATIONS

Three models, one cabinet platform.

A battery energy storage system (BESS) stores energy so it can be used later. The ReMod commercial & industrial family ships in three modular cabinet configurations — full specifications below.

Specification ReModCB1-373-05 ReModCB1-373-10 ReModCB1-418-05
Rated energy372.7 kWh372.7 kWh418 kWh
C-rate0.5C / 0.5C1C / 1C0.5C / 0.5C
Operating voltage900–1500 Vdc1165–1500 Vdc1165–1500 Vdc
CellLFP 280 AhLFP 280 AhLFP 314 Ah
Max charge / discharge140 / 140 A280 / 280 A157 / 157 A
Configuration1P416S1P416S1P416S
Charging temp.0 ~ 45 °C0 ~ 45 °C0 ~ 45 °C
Discharging temp.-20 ~ 50 °C-20 ~ 50 °C-20 ~ 50 °C
CoolingLiquid coolingLiquid coolingLiquid cooling
CommunicationCAN · RS485CAN · RS485CAN · RS485
Dimensions1300 × 1300 × 2375 mm1300 × 1300 × 2375 mm1300 × 1300 × 2375 mm
Weight~4,000 kg~4,000 kg~4,000 kg
ProtectionIP55IP55IP55
WHERE IT'S USED

Smarter energy for industry.

Peak shaving

Reduces energy use during the busiest, costliest hours.

Demand management

Smooths industrial load to control peak demand charges.

Backup & UPS

Keeps critical operations running through grid outages.

Solar self-consumption

Stores on-site solar to use when the facility needs it.

Load shifting

Moves consumption to cheaper, cleaner hours of the day.
